What are electric motorcycles?
Electric motorcycles are motorcycles powered by an electric motor or motors. They use rechargeable batteries instead of the traditional internal combustion engines. These batteries are charged using electricity from a power source such as an electrical outlet. Electric motorcycles have no clutch, no transmission, and no gears, making them easier to ride than traditional motorcycles. Their unique features make them an excellent choice for eco-friendly riders looking to reduce their carbon footprint.

Charging an electric motorcycle
To better appreciate electric motorcycles, we need to understand how they are charged. The batteries in electric motorcycles can be charged either at home or at charging stations. Some motorcycles have removable batteries, which you can take to your home or office and charge from there. These batteries can be charged with a standard home outlet, which takes about six to eight hours. Rapid charging stations are also available and can charge electric motorcycles in a matter of minutes. Electric motorcycles usually have a range of 60-100 miles in one charge, making them a perfect choice for shorter distances.

Electric motorcycles are cost-efficient
Electric motorcycles are cost-efficient when it comes to fuel and maintenance. Because they have no engine or transmission, electric motorcycles have fewer moving parts that wear down. As a result, they require less maintenance, making them more economical than traditional motorcycles. Meanwhile, the cost of charging an electric motorcycle is significantly lower than buying gasoline. This cost-saving benefit helps make electric motorcycles a practical option for riders who want to save money long-term.
